Zurich Financial Services Group (Zurich) has announced that its majority-owned South African business, SA Eagle, will operate under the global Zurich brand and the registered name Zurich Insurance Company South Africa Limited. Zurich says the move demonstrates its commitment to this operation and to the South African market.
John Amore, Zurich’s global CEO General Insurance and member of the Group Executive Committee said, “We are excited about launching the Zurich brand in South Africa. The in-depth understanding of the local insurance sector that our team in South Africa has, combined with the Group’s global risk management capabilities and the access to our global platforms, positions it well to achieve further growth in this important market.”
Nick Beyers, CEO of Zurich in South Africa, said, “This is so much more significant than a simple name change. While the existing trusted relationships with our customers and partners will remain, this move demonstrates that we are part of a global Group, with the experience of 135 years serving customers across the world.”
The Zurich brand is being launched in South Africa with a major national advertising brand campaign with the tagline “Because change happens.”
